About Woody Guthrie’s Songs To Grow On:
Cathy Ann Guthrie is full of questions about the world around her, but she’s never left
home. When her parents take her on a cross-country road trip, she encounters difficult
truths that teach them to grow together. Joining our trio along that ribbon of highway, the
audience experiences a musical journey through dance, folk art storytelling, and
interactive play. Inspired by an unpublished manuscript and featuring classic songs such
as “Riding In My Car” and “This Land Is Your Land”, this play encourages curiosity and
promotes empathy through question based learning.
